Tony Hwang, serving his fifth term, represents Connecticut’s 28th District. A Chief Deputy Republican Leader, he is the Ranking Member of the Aging, Transportation and Insurance and Real Estate Committees, and a member of numerous other committees. Tony is the first Asian-Pacific American State Senator in Connecticut history and has been honored for his commitment to strengthening communities, youth development, healthy living and social responsibility.

⚠️🚘 CTDOT is announcing bridge work will be performed on I-84 Old Hawleyville Road Overpass and Parmalee Hill Road Overpass in Newtown, and the Route 6 Overpass in Bethel starting on Monday April 21, 2025.
The Connecticut Department of Transportation (CTDOT) is announcing bridge work will be performed on I-84 Old Hawleyville Road Overpass and Parmalee Hill Road Overpass in Newtown, and the Route 6 Overpass in Bethel. This project is scheduled to occur on Monday April 21 and be completed on Monday, June 23, 2025. This project ensures the bridges remain in a state of good repair.
This project is being performed by Hammonasset Construction.
LANE CLOSURE/DETOUR INFO
There will be lane closures on I-84 from Monday, April 21 to Monday, June 23, 2025, from 7:30 p.m. to 5:30 a.m. Traffic control signing patterns will be in place with State Police to guide motorists through the work zone.
Motorists should be aware that modifications or extensions to this schedule may become necessary due to weather delays or other unforeseen conditions. Motorists are advised to maintain a safe speed when driving in this area.
